ARUP Launches First Clinical Spectral Flow Cytometry Assay for MRD Assessment in Multiple Myeloma

ARUP Laboratories announced the launch of ARUP CLARISPECT™, a new clinical spectral flow cytometry assay for minimal residual disease (MRD) assessment in multiple myeloma patients. The assay aims to detect small neoplastic populations with greater sensitivity than conventional flow cytometry methods.
